At St Joseph’s, we keep our parents, carers and families informed about upcoming events and celebrations of our children’s successes. We regularly publish a newsletter, which is sent out electronically to all of our parents and is made available on this page. We also use Social media to share the very latest events, learning and religious celebrations that take place within our school.
